Can I upload video or audio examples from copyrighted or commercially licensed works to DUiT?

0

In short, NO. It is absolutely crucial that the content uploaded is allowed to be legally distributed. If you would like to include copyrighted or commercially licensed work on your DUiT site, consult with the Fair Use Guidelines to determine what amount of material is acceptable to post. If possible, and get in touch with the copyright holder to request permission to use the work. As always, when in doubt, assume the materials you are considering are not “okay” to put online and do your homework to find out where the materials have come from and what the rights are.
